TSMC to put USD 12 bln into building 5 nm chip plant in Arizona

2020-05-15 09:14: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ing (TSMC) has announced it is ready to put USD 12 billion into a chip factory in the US. The factory would come to Arizona, where Intel also has plants. With support from both federal and state government, construction will begin next year with production targeted for 2024. TSMC explained that it will use its 5-nanometer technology and produce 20,000 semiconductor wafer per month. The TSMC statement comes after the US government recently made it clear it wants to promote more tech self-sufficiency.

US govt in talks with Intel, TSMC to develop chip 'self-reliance'

2020-05-11 09:41: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) Officials from the US government are in talks with Intel and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ing (TSMC) to build chip factories in the US, the Wall Street Journal reported, citing sources familiar with the matter. The government believes the pandemic showed how reliant the US is on Asian factories and it now wants to promote more tech self-sufficiency. Intel VP of policy and tech affairs Greg Slater said Intel's plan would be to operate a plant that could provide advanced chips securely for both the government and other customers. "We think it's a good opportunity," he added. "The timing is better and the demand for this is greater than it has been in the past, even from the commercial side."

MediaTek 8K DTV SoC begins volume production at TSMC

2019-11-08 13:00:07| Digital TV News

MediaTek (TWSE: 2454) and TSMC (TWSE: 2330, NYSE: TSM) have announced that the industrys first 8K digital TV SoC manufactured with 12nm technology, the MediaTek S900, has entered volume manufacturing with TSMC.
